Role Overview The Analyst role is to provide support to the project preparation process under direct and continuous supervision from Operation Leaders. The key focus will be on the credit and financial aspects of project development and implementation with special responsibility for financial modelling and analysis, but the analyst will be expected to participate in all aspects of project development and implementation. An Analyst may progress to more complex aspects of transaction processing, progressively gaining more responsibilities.
Key Responsibilities and Deliverables
Credit and financial aspects of project development, including financial analysis of companies - data gathering, construction and analysis of financial projections and structuring of financing agreements. A particular focus is on transactions in the area of municipal infrastructure (MEI) and Corporate Sector.
Research, analyse and provide background information into companies
Support the Bank's sector teams in regular monitoring of existing projects.
Draft specific assigned portions of Bank documents and correspondence
Participate in project implementation, including administrative and analytical support in specific areas of project monitoring
Attend meetings with clients with more senior bankers. Liaison with the Bank's internal Credit department, and other support units.
